GPT-3, the latest state-of-the-art in Deep Learning, achieved incredible results in a range of language tasks without additional training. The main difference between this model and its predecessor was in terms of size.

GPT-3 was trained on hundreds of billions of words — nearly the whole Internet — yielding a wildly compute-heavy, 175 billion parameter model.

OpenAI’s authors note that we can’t scale models forever:
